BUILDING TIMELINE
27/3/15 - land titles issued
17/04/15 - settlement on land
01/05/15 - Prestart completed
05/06/15 - Final Documents finished and sent out
08/06/15 - Entered the scheduling department
15/06/15 - Final Docs signed off and variations put through
15/06/15 - building permit application sent to council
26/06/15 - building permit approved
17/06/15 - scheduling completed earth works estimated for the 24th July
24/07/15 - earthworks started! Woohoo!
27/07/15 - pipe work completed
28/07/15 - mesh and footings and reinforcing completed
29/07/15 - slab pour booked (no slab completed yet)
30/07/15 - slab down! Yippiee!
31/07/15 - soak wells delivered and invoice for slab received
05/08/15 - soak wells put in and site clean booked for 10/07
10/08/15 - site clean completed and yellow sand delivered for bricks
12/08/15 - bricks delivered, awaiting brick layer confirmation
17/08/15 - bricklayer started
20/08/15 - site meeting
24/09/15 - bricks finished plate height reached
25/09/15 - brickwork building inspector to site
26/09/15 - roof timbers delivered
02/10/15 - roof timbers finished and eaves completed
07/10/15 - pre plumbing and pre electrical completed
08/10/15 - colourbond delivered
09/10/15 - colourbond finished
15/10/15 - grey float completed
20/10/15 - ceilings finished
21/10/15 - cornices finished
02/10/15 - white set finished
03/10/15 - windows and sliding doors installed
04/11/15 - lock up complete
05/11/15 - ceilings and doors painted and wardrobes installed
11/11/15 - bath installed
12/11/15 - Cabinets installed, bench tops installed and first coat of render completed
17/11/15 - Grano down
19/11/15 - Tile meeting
21/11/15 - Tiling started
23/11/15 - Tiling of bathrooms finished
24/11/15 - Driveway prep and pavers delivered
25/11/15 - Toilets Delivered
30/11/15 - Render Completed
01/12/15 - Driveway Completed
09/12/15 - Aircon installed
16/12/15 - Final plumbing and electrical completed
17/12/15 - Garage door on and final painting completed
18/12/15 - House site clean completed
04/01/16 - Carpet Installed
05/01/16 - Flyscreens installed
13/01/16 - PCI Booked for 22nd Jan!
22/01/16 - PCI Completed with building inspector and SS
10/02/16 - KEYS!
15/02/16 - Tiling started
24/02/16 - Tiling Finished
24/02/16 - Bulkhead started
26/02/16 - Bulkhead Finished
29/02/16 - Electrician
02/03/16 - Painter
18/03/16 - Moved in!
30/03/16 - concrete
09/04/16 - planter boxes completed

Luck and the following:
1. Only deal in email
2. Keep track of everything, ask for clarification and never take no for an answer
3. Know that when they say six months admin, six months build, they really mean eight months admin and up to 10 months build.
4. A deep love of alcohol

If you want to choose crosby or european ceramics you have to let homegroupwa know before your tile appointment.
when you go to the tile places just ask one of the sales people to walk you through it, they are very good with knowing what is included/what will be upgrades etc. If you are wanting to keep to a budget stay away from anything porcelain, rectified or larger/odd shaped tiles
Kat
You can choose above 45sqm allowance, HGWA will pass on the cost. I found crosby fantastic to deal with but they are always really busy
